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items can differ between airlines, the general guide to follow is nothing fl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es things like screwdrivers, blades, spray paint and flares. Sports equipment like hockey sticks, and objects that could harm passengers, such as pepper spray and firearms, aren’t allowed in the cabin either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The narrow aisles of your plane are not the place for a fashion parade. Layer yourself up with comfortable clothes and pack a sweater as it tends to get cool inside the cabin during longer flights. Enclosed, flat shoes are also a good choice.
  • Unfortunately, a risk of long-haul flights is developing de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ity. To avoid this, take every opportunity to wander around the cabin. Compression socks and tights are another simple way to help minimize this ris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to June Lake?
A little pre-planning before your flight will make your trip to June Lake a breeze. Here are some useful tips for a swift journey through security:

  • Be sure to have your ID and boarding pass at hand. They’re the first things you’ll be asked for by airport security.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your coat, belt, keys and other contents of your pockets, like coins,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n arrives.
  • All electronic devices, including your tablet and phone, must also be scanned separately.
  • Travelling with a new hand and nail cream? As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it’s stored in a clear zip-close bag, you can keep it with you in your carry-on.
  • There’s a good chance you’ll be required to take your shoes off to be X-rayed,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a wise idea.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p or pointed objects in your hand lugg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, check them in.
